The Seemingly Endless Saga of Harry Aldridge (AKA "Bootleg") Cont'd |
![]() |
1980 - 1982 "Look Ma, I'm A Beatle! " |
|
| by Harry Aldridge Mark and I were contacted by aliens? No! We were contacted by old friends of Mark to join a Beatlemania production out of Milwaukee, Wisconsin. We used my recording name and called it, "Bootleg - A Tribute to The Beatles". What a thrill and challenge it was to perform the songs of my idols every night all over this great country. After a year, we moved our home base to Atlanta. After another year of being on the road with the production company, I was burned out and ready to stay at home with my family. 1982 - 1989 "A Cold Turkey In Atlanta" I hid my guitar underneath my bed and became a dealer of collectable books and records. I was a full time husband and father for the first time ever. Nice! 1990 to Present I saw John Adams, old Bushmen band mate, at a Paul McCartney concert in Atlanta. John had kept The Bushmen group going for all these years and we decided to do it again. I moved to Brunswick, Georgia in 1990, and I've been playing ever since for conventions, dances, concerts, etc. We play the music that we grew up on and I love it! I've built a studio, Abby Road South, behind our old 1880's Victorian house and I've got my second wind at writing and recording again. Lifes' Good On The Golden Isles! But It's Good Anywhere - When You're The Center Of The Universe! "Let It Be!" Love, Bootleg (Harry Aldridge)
